The Indiana Pacers enter the 2020 NBA Draft with one selection.

Unless the Indiana Pacers trade during the NBA Draft, they will only make one selection, which comes at the end of the second round. Recent history suggests their rookies may take a bit to get on the court, especially second-round selections. What can they expect from their draft pick in 2020-21?

Regardless of who is selected with the 54th pick, there should not be any immediate expectations for his first season. The Pacers already have plenty of quality players in the rotation and a few young guys who are ready to take the next step. Goga Bitadze, Alize Johnson, and Edmond Sumner are all primed for a larger role in the rotation this season.

However, the second round of the draft will likely offer two separate scenarios for teams picking late. The first option being the opportunity to draft a younger prospect who left school early despite not being as prepared as his peers. The other, then, is to find a senior prospect who may slide due to being three or four years older.

If Indiana goes with a young guy, there is almost no reason for him to see the floor right away. Instead, they can give him extra minutes in the G-League while he adds to his game. But if the Pacers take an older player like Markus Howard or Sam Merrill, they could find a way to use their experience.

First-round picks with the Pacers have not seen a lot of playing time early in their careers. It is hard to imagine a second-round pick will have a different experience. The Pacers have a strong eight-man rotation in place with depth beyond that as well.

The smart play is to draft someone who can eventually provide depth at a position of future need. With Victor Oladipo‘s future in the air still, drafting a guard or wing player with developmental upside might be the best option.
